Open-Bath Immersion Cooling System is an advanced thermal management solution that involves submerging electronic components or other heat-generating equipment directly into a non-conductive cooling medium. This method effectively dissipates heat by immersing the entire system or specific parts within a bath of coolant, enhancing cooling efficiency and reliability.
